How they compare
Bhutan currently reports 95.0% against 94.7% in Guyana,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 17 shared years of data; in 1971 it was Guyana ahead.
Bhutan ranks 108th and Guyana ranks 110th of 206 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Bhutan averaged higher in 1 and Guyana in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bhutan | Guyana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 22.9% | 87.7% | 64.8% | Guyana |
| 1980s | 52.4% | 85.8% | 33.3% | Guyana |
| 1990s | 59.3% | 91.4% | 32.1% | Guyana |
| 2000s | 73.0% | 94.8% | 21.8% | Guyana |
| 2010s | 85.8% | 100.8% | 14.9% | Guyana |
| 2020s | 92.6% | 91.7% | 0.9% | Bhutan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
